The Sun Hydraulics FPFKXBV724N (FPFKXBV724N) is a pilot-operated, normally closed, electroproportional throttle with reverse flow check. This advanced hydraulic component is designed to precisely control fluid flow in a variety of hydraulic systems. Its electroproportional functionality allows for smooth and adjustable throttling of hydraulic fluid, making it suitable for applications that require precise flow modulation and control. The reverse flow check feature ensures that fluid can only flow in one direction under normal operating conditions, preventing backflow and potential system damage. This makes the FPFKXBV724N an ideal choice for complex hydraulic circuits where maintaining directional control is crucial. The pilot-operated design enhances the valve's responsiveness and efficiency by utilizing system pressure to assist in opening the valve, reducing the electrical power required to operate it. This component is particularly useful in applications where energy efficiency and precise control are paramount.
